Question: The 5-lb cylinder is falling from A with a speed v = 10 ft/s onto the platform. Determine the maximum displacement of the platform, caused by the collision. The spring has an unstretched length of 1.75 ft and is originally kept in compression by the 1-ft long cables attached to the platform. Neglect the mass of the platform and spring and any energy lost during the collision.
Problem 14-25 from:
Engineering Mechanics: Dynamics, 14th edition
Russell C. Hibbeler
